Description
This three-bedroom, semi-detached house is located on Church Road in Smethwick. This property has the addition of being partially triple glazed. The ground floor features a through-lounge reception room and a downstairs washroom, offering practical spaces for day-to-day living and hosting guests. The kitchen is positioned at the rear of the property, providing a straightforward workspace for cooking and dining. Upstairs, there are three bedrooms and a family bathroom, giving a balanced layout for various household requirements.
Smethwick Rolfe Street and Smethwick Galton Bridge train stations are within a reasonable distance for regular services into Birmingham, Wolverhampton, and surrounding areas. Local bus routes connect the neighbourhood with adjacent districts, and the M5 motorway is accessible for broader travel needs.
Daily essentials can be found within walking or short driving distance. Windmill Shopping Centre and Bearwood High Street both offer a variety of shops, supermarkets, and dining options. For more extensive shopping, Birmingham city centre is a few miles away and reachable by public transport or car.
Victoria Park and Warley Woods are both located within a short drive, offering opportunities for walks, exercise, and outdoor gatherings. Nearby fitness centres, including Smethwick Swimming Centre, provide additional leisure options.
Several primary and secondary schools operate in the local area, making Church Road a practical choice for families.
